How they compare
Malta currently reports 99.0% against 76.6% in Lithuania, a difference of 22.4%.
That makes Malta's figure about 1.3 times Lithuania's.
Across all 5 years both countries report, Malta has been ahead every year.
Lithuania ranks 3rd and Malta ranks 1st of 29 countries.
Malta has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
